①SIGNAL STRENGTH INDICATOR
Indicates relative signal strength level.
② LOW POWER INDICATOR
Appears when low output power is selected.
•When high output power is selected, no
indicator appears.
③ AUDIBLE INDICATOR
Appears when the channel is in the 'audible'
(unmute) condition.
④ COMPANDER INDICATOR
Appears when the compander function* is
activated.
*Analog mode operation only.
⑤ SCRAMBLER INDICATOR

⑥ BELL INDICATOR
Appears/blinks when the specific page call* is
received, according to the pre-programming.
*P25 operation only.
⑦ TELEPHONE INDICATOR
Appears when a phone call* is received.
*P25 operation only.
